Dimension #1: Reliability in Forward/Reverse Applications

ABB contactor vs Generic – this is where the gap shows up fast.

In March 2024, 36 hours before a deadline, a client called me: their conveyor system was stuck in reverse. They'd swapped a failed ABB A30-30-10 with a 'universal' contactor from a discount supplier. The forward/reverse interlock was flaky – the generic had loose tolerances on the mechanical interlock mechanism. It worked for three days, then welded shut.

With the original ABB contactor, the interlock is precision-machined. The air gap is consistent. For forward/reverse motor control (which requires reliable electrical and mechanical isolation), that consistency is non-negotiable. Generics often skimp on the interlock assembly – it's the most expensive part to get right. I've seen 4 out of 10 generic contactors fail in a reversing configuration within 6 months (based on our internal data from 47 replacement orders).

Bottom line: If your circuit involves forward/reverse sequencing, do not use generic alternatives. The cost of a production halt will dwarf the savings.

Dimension #3: Documentation & Support (The ABB Manual Advantage)

When you buy an ABB contactor, you get access to the full ABB contactor manual – wiring diagrams, torque specs, timing charts, cleaner recommendations, interlock adjustment procedures. These manuals are free online. I reference them weekly for ABB A30-30-10, AF09, AF96, you name it.

Generic contactor – what do you get? A photocopied sheet in Chinglish (if you're lucky) or a QR code that leads to a dead link. I've tried to get wiring diagrams for generic 'alternatives' and ended up reverse-engineering from photos. That's time you don't have.

For emergency replacements – like when a client's order arrives with a critical error and you have 48 hours to fix it – the manual is your lifeline. Without it, you're guessing. And guessing on a live circuit? Not a good idea.

Dimension #4: Total Cost of Ownership Under Stress

Let's talk money. A generic ABB A30-30-10 alternative might cost $45 versus $120 for the genuine part. That's a 63% saving on paper. Here's what the paper doesn't show:

  • Failure rate: 3% vs 15% in our first-year data (based on 200+ rush orders, 2024)
  • Downtime cost per hour: $200–$800 depending on the line
  • Rush shipping for replacement: $50–$150 extra (when you need it next day)
  • Maintenance labor: Generics often require more frequent cleaning and adjustment

Add it up: if a generic fails after 6 months, you've paid $45 + $100 rush shipping + 1 hour of electrician time ($85) + downtime cost (say $400). That's $630 for the pleasure of 'saving' $75. The original ABB contactor, at $120, would still be running.
